This is my second time coming here with my kids and we’ve been eating sushi our whole lives. I didn’t think there was any place that could pull off a sushi buffet, but this place is a “Legend.” All you can eat sushi and sashimi, all 3 of us, well under $100, and no sacrifice to quality. The restaurant was clean, fish was fresh, the rolls were visually and tastefully appealing and the service was a 10/10 (which is rare at most buffets, and again with children).Being half Japanese, from Hawaii, and a life long lover of sushi, I highly recommend this place.

the food is honestly not bad since the all you can eat lunch price is only $17.99! definitely the most bang for your buck AYCE sushi in the area. sushi rolls were great, appetizers were okay (i would skip). for sushi itself, the fish was super fresh but they do add a lot of rice. also, no wasabi!
